Understanding Data Science

At its core, data science is an interdisciplinary field that combines techniques from statistics, mathematics, and computer science to extract insights and knowledge from data. The goal is to uncover patterns, trends, and valuable information that can inform decision-making processes. Data scientists utilize a variety of tools and techniques to analyze and interpret data, ultimately transforming it into actionable insights.

Key Components of Data Science

  1. Data Collection: The foundation of any data science project is the data itself. Gathering relevant and high-quality data is the first step in the process. This can involve collecting data from various sources, including databases, APIs, sensors, and more.

  2. Data Cleaning and Preprocessing: Raw data is often messy and may contain errors or missing values. Data scientists spend a significant amount of time cleaning and preprocessing the data to ensure its accuracy and reliability. This step is crucial for obtaining meaningful results.

  3. Exploratory Data Analysis (EDA): EDA involves visually and statistically exploring the data to identify patterns, trends, and anomalies. This phase helps data scientists gain a deeper understanding of the dataset and formulate hypotheses for further analysis.

  4. Feature Engineering: Feature engineering involves selecting, transforming, or creating new features from the existing dataset. This step aims to enhance the predictive power of machine learning models by providing them with relevant information.

  5. Model Building: Machine learning models are at the heart of data science. Various algorithms, such as linear regression, decision trees, and neural networks, can be employed depending on the nature of the problem.   6. Model Evaluation: Once a model is built, it needs to be evaluated to ensure its effectiveness. Common evaluation metrics include accuracy, precision, recall, and F1 score. Data scientists use these metrics to assess the model's performance and make necessary adjustments.

  7. Deployment: Deploying a model involves integrating it into a production environment where it can make predictions on new, unseen data. This phase requires collaboration between data scientists and IT professionals to ensure a seamless transition from development to deployment.

Applications of Data Science

The applications of data science are vast and continue to grow across various industries. Some notable areas include:

  1. Healthcare: Data science is revolutionizing healthcare by providing insights into patient outcomes, personalized medicine, and disease prediction.

  2. Finance: In the financial sector, data science is used for fraud detection, risk management, algorithmic trading, and customer segmentation.

  3. Marketing: Marketers leverage data science to analyze customer behavior, optimize advertising campaigns, and personalize user experiences.

  4. E-commerce: Data science powers recommendation systems, demand forecasting, and inventory management in the e-commerce industry.

  5. Education: In education, data science helps improve learning outcomes by analyzing student performance, predicting dropout rates, and tailoring educational content.

Challenges and Ethical Considerations

While data science holds great promise, it also faces challenges and ethical considerations. Privacy concerns, biased algorithms, and the responsible use of data are critical issues that data scientists must navigate.
